Why is Gasoline Conversion A popular choice within Thailand?
Nice of gas conversion throughout Thailand isn’t merely a trend; it’s an economic requirement for most.

1. The Cost Differential
The primary driver is easy economics. Fuel rates in Thailand can easily fluctuate drastically as a result of global markets and native taxes. Historically, the purchase price difference between conventional petrol (Gasohol 95) and LPG or even NGV can end up being substantial, often trimming the fuel price per kilometer by 50% or even more. This rapid return on investment (ROI) the actual initial price of installation minimal for frequent individuals.

2. Infrastructure plus Availability
Unlike a lot of Western countries where finding an alternate gas station can require major detours, Thailand’s infrastructure is purpose-built for gas alteration.

LPG (Liquefied Petroleum Gas): This is the most common conversion, also known as “Autogas. ” LPG stations are ubiquitous, found in almost every city and even along major arterial roads.
NGV (Natural Gas Vehicle) / CNG: While commonly clustered around major cities and industrial zones (making this perfect for logistics companies), the NGV fuel price is definitely often the cheapest per unit of vitality.
3. Government and even Regulatory Approval
Typically the Thai Department of Land Transport (DLT) regulates and inspects all gas conversions. This regulation ensures safety standards will be met, removing much of the get worried linked to home-grown conversion rate found elsewhere.

LPG vs. NGV: Deciding on the Right “Gas Mount”
When selecting a conversion, Thailänder drivers generally choose between two systems:

Feature LPG (Liquefied Petroleum Gas) NGV (Natural Gas Vehicle) / CNG
Energy Cost Very low (higher than NGV, yet cheaper than petrol) The lowest fuel price per kilometer
Availability Excellent (Easy to get stations everywhere) Limited (Mostly major highways in addition to urban centers)
Preliminary Installation Lower (Approx. twenty five, 000–40, 000 THB) Higher (Approx. 40, 000–60, 000 THB)
Tank Size/Weight Lighter, smaller tanks (donut tanks popular) Heavy, large high-pressure storage containers
Range Good range, comparable to petrol Shorter range per tank credited to high strain
The Takeaway: Regarding the average drivers who prioritizes comfort and range, LPG is the preferred choice in Thailand. Taxis and heavy-duty vehicles often go for NGV due to the absolute least expensive operating cost, in spite of the inconvenience of fewer stations.

Typically the Conversion Process: Safety and Legality
Transforming your car inside Thailand is a new standardized procedure, yet choosing a high quality installer is essential for safety plus engine longevity.

just one. Look for a Certified Installer
Never use non-certified mechanics. Reputable Thailänder installers use globally recognized brands (like AC Stag, BRC, Versus, or Power Reform) and offer warranty support. A quality shop will test the program rigorously and ensure seamless transition between petrol and gas.

2. The Assembly
A modern gasoline conversion system doesn’t replace the motor; it adds some sort of secondary fuel system.

Components: This consists of a gas tank (usually placed in the particular spare wheel okay or trunk), a separate ECU (Engine Control Unit) to manage the gas injectors, a vaporizer/reducer, and new injector rails.
The Move: The car typically starts on petrol and automatically buttons to gas when the engine stretches to operating temperature.
Installation Time: The method typically takes 1 to be able to 2 days.
3. Legal and Security Requirements
This can be the majority of critical step plus where Thailand stands out in its legislation:

Certification: After assembly, the shop must issue a certified installation document.
Evaluation: The vehicle must be taken to a new certified engineer intended for inspection and stress testing. This engineer verifies the installation meets DLT standards.
Registration: Finally, the particular vehicle registration guide (lemn thabian) should be updated at the particular local DLT office to reflect typically the new fuel method.
Crucially: You must have the particular gas system inspected annually during your vehicle’s regular registration course of action. Failure to do so signifies your car insurance may be voided in the case of an crash.

Myth Busting: Truly does Gas Damage the particular Engine?
This is a typical concern among new converts, however the modern day consensus is apparent:

Motor Wear: Modern sequential injection gas methods are highly complex. They deliver the fuel efficiently and even rarely cause harm if installed effectively on modern, Japanese-engineered engines (Toyota, Kia, Mazda, etc. ).
Reputable Brands: Making use of high-quality components and proper calibration prevents the engine through running too low fat (which causes overheating).
Valve Lubrication: Several sensitive engines may well require digging in a valve lubrication method (often a small grease drip device) to prevent premature regulators seat wear, a little extra cost that ensures engine longevity.
